I brush and floss regularly. Why do I need mouthwash?
BRUSHING ALONE IS NOT ENOUGH
Research reveals that brushing only removes approximately
30%-53%
of plaque1

dental_plaque_new.gif

Bacteria build-up (plaque) remains in the mouth and eventually hardens to form tartar, which can no longer be removed by brushing

Brush, Floss and Rinse Study We're backed by science. A study2 showed a noticeable reduction in plaque in users of mouthwash containing essential oils compared to control groups.
BCBrush and Rinse with Other Mouthwash
BFCBrush, Floss, and Rinse with Other Mouthwash
BFEOBrush, Floss, and Rinse with Essential Oil Mouthwash
BC Group
(Control 1)
BFC Group
(Control 2)
BFEO Group

The BFEO Group showed a 56.3% reduction in plaque from Control 1, while the BFC Group only showed a 9.3% reduction.
